Role Description
The Salon Manager is a full-time, on-site role based in Ballwin, MO. The person in this role oversees daily salon operations, including managing appointment flow, maintaining service standards, and ensuring a welcoming environment for guests and team members. Responsibilities include supervising and coaching stylists, supporting professional development, and leading by example in delivering excellent hair care services. The Salon Manager handles staffing needs such as interviewing, hiring, onboarding, and scheduling, while monitoring performance and adherence to company policies.
This role also involves resolving customer concerns, promoting salon services and products, and collaborating with leadership on business goals, sales targets, and community engagement.
